Like it or not, we’re now dealing with Apotheosis uptime and casting more Holy Words. This is especially true due to our 4-Piece tier set bonus. The Renew with the cooldown is almost entirely for cooldown reduction for Sanctify, should you choose to use it. The damage profiles in the new raid seem to center around 1-3 minute marks repeating. If Salvation were still in the game, I’m not sure it would even be useful.

Coming up with a talent tree that you enjoy is going to be tough. We have a lot of free points in the top half of the tree but some tough decisions to make on the bottom three nodes. Many of the choices are 2-5% each and depend on how you want to play. Though I think most people will suggest that going down the right side into Answered Prayers is vital, not only because of the tier set but because of the cooldown reduction for Holy Words.

It’s a change for sure. I’m still getting used to not having my CoH. The Empowered Renew has replaced its spot on my keyboard.

The increased Lightweaver to four stacks so that it’s easier to manage. For M+ we’re still doing Lightweaver just Flash Heal and Heal spam. Though the new talent below Apotheosis granting three instant cast PoH might be useful for large AoE damage. There’s now a talent that increases the size of Sanctify and that helps for M+ quite a bit too.

Holy priest 4 set? Isn’t that just a % increase in healing based on the number of inspirations you have out? How are you calculating that as 4th on healing?

The 4 piece makes your holy words within Apotheosis apply Insurance (though only one target in Sanc’s case).

All the changes were based around lowering holy word CDs and extending Apotheosis windows. So you end up getting way more Insurance healing.
